Bunn is a perfect 7-0 against Northern Nash since April of 2022 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Thursday. The Bunn Wildcats will head out to square off against the Northern Nash Knights at 6:00 p.m. Both squads will be entering this one on the heels of a big victory.
Northern Nash will be up against a hot Bunn team: the squad just extended their winning streak to three. Bunn put the hurt on Rocky Mount with a sharp 23-4 victory on Tuesday.
Emily Baez looked comfortable as she tossed one inning while giving up no earned runs off one hit.
At the plate, Bunn let Payton Wood and Maycey Buchanan run wild. Wood went a perfect 4-for-4 with three runs, four RBI, and two doubles, while Buchanan went 3-for-4 with three runs, four RBI, and one triple. That's the most RBI Wood has posted since back in March of 2024. Another player making a difference was Madeline Bryson, who went 2-for-4 with three runs, one triple, and one RBI.
Bunn k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 18 hits.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now got at least 13 hits every time they've taken the field this season.
Meanwhile, Northern Nash hadn't done well against Beddingfield recently (they were 1-7 in their previous eight mat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Tuesday. Northern Nash never let Beddingfield get on the board and left with an 18-0 win. The home team had taken home the W every time these teams have met since March 19, 2019, but that streak is no more.
Emily Clay was a major factor no matter where she played. On the mound, she didn't allow a single earned run and allowed only two hits while striking out eight over five innings pitched.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't given up more than one earned run in three consecutive appearances. She was also big at the plate, going 2-for-3 with three stolen bases, five RBI, and two runs. With that strong performance, she is now averaging an impressive 1.2 stolen bases per game.
In other batting news, Emma Hunt and Kailey Burden did most of the damage at the plate: Hunt scored four runs and stole Two bases. while getting on base in four of her five plate appearances, while Burden scored two runs and stole Two bases. while getting on base in four of her five plate appearances. Hunt continues to improve, besting her previous point total in each of the last three games she's played. Hayley Moss was another key player, scoring two runs and stealing Two bases. while going 2-for-5.
Northern Nash's victory bumped their record up to 3-1. As for Bunn, their win bumped their record up to 3-0.
Thursday's matchup might come down to which pitcher can control the ball better. Bunn has hit smart this season, having averaged an OBP of .555. However, it's not like Northern Nash struggles in that department as they've averaged .609. With both teams so capable at the plate, fans should be ready for an impressive hitting performance.
Everything went Bunn's way against Northern Nash in their previous matchup back in April of 2024, as Bunn made off with an 18-8 victory. Will Bunn repeat their success, or does Northern Nash have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
